2014 Moab Easter Jeep Safari Kicks Off in Style

Off-road enthusiasts from all over the world gathered this Monday in Utah to take part in the 48th Annual Moab Easter Jeep Safari. The week-long event consisting of adventurous trail rides is also the perfect place for Jeep and Mopar to showcase their six new concept vehicles.

As we've told you a little while back, those concepts are actually Wrangler, Cherokee and Grand Cherokee models with added Mopar design accessories and performance parts. Check the full specs and photo gallery by following this link.

Since 2002, Jeep and Mopar have joined hands to create over 40 unique concept vehicles for enthusiasts who attend the popular Moab Easter Jeep Safari. But this isn't just your usual marketing affair.

Jeep knows that this is a huge celebration of everything off-road and the perfect place to bring out the big guns in its model lineup. The gnarly terrain littered with rocks and ruts is just what the Chrysler brand needs in order to show hardcore fans and potential customers what Jeep products are capable of when the going gets rough.
